Aspects to Consider When Choosing a Driving School

Picking a driving school can be frustrating, offered the wide range of choices readily available. Below are the crucial factors to consider:

FactorDescription
ReputationLook for schools with favorable reviews and reviews.
AccreditationGuarantee the school is licensed and meets local guidelines.
Trainer QualificationsExamine the qualifications and experience of the instructors.
CurriculumEvaluation the course offerings, including classroom and behind-the-wheel training.
PricesCompare the cost of lessons and packages.
FlexibilityValidate if the school offers flexible scheduling options.
LocationChoose a school that is conveniently located.
Pass RatesResearch study the school's success rates for passing driving tests.

Additional Resources for New Drivers

Apart from picking a driving school, there are various resources that can enhance an amateur driver's knowledge and skills:

  1. State DMV Resources: Many state Departments of Motor Vehicles offer free guides and practice tests.
  2. Online Tutorials: Websites and platforms like YouTube host numerous training videos on driving techniques and guidelines of the road.
  3. Books: Driver's handbooks are available for many states and cover important laws, guidelines, and ideas for safe driving.
